Brian Hall has been living with Parkinson's since he was 14. He is now in his 60s. How do you fill the well of optimism when it's been drained progressively and constantly for well over 40 years?
2023
2022
2024
1949
2012
1957
2011
2020
2009
2025
2004
1985
1994
2015
2001
2018
1971